Main-Dish Lentil-Vegetable Soup
Serves 4
* 1 Tbs. olive oil
* 1/4 c chopped yellow onion
* 1 leek chopped
* 1/4 tsp roasted garlic (dried)
* 3 carrots cut into 1/4-inch dice
* 2 small potatos cut into small cubes
* 3 stalks celery cut into 1/4-inch dice
* 2 mild peppers chopped
* 1 1/4 cups dried brown lentils
* 6 cups vegetable stock (I used 4 cups veg broth, 2 cups no-chicken broth)
* 1 1/2 Tbs. tamari soy sauce
* Salt and lots of freshly ground black pepper
* 1 tsp italian herbs
STOVETOP METHOD: Heat oil in stockpot over medium heat. Add onion and cook 5 minutes to soften. Add remaining vegetables and saute about 5 minutes till beginning to soften. Add lentils, stock, tamari, and seasonings. Reduce heat to low. Cover, and cook, stirring from time to time, until lentils and vegetables are tender, ~45 minutes to 1 hour. Taste and adjust seasonings, if necessary.
Here's the CROCKPOT Method for reference:
1. Heat oil in skillet over medium heat. Add onion, cover and cook until softened, about 5 minutes; transfer to slow cooker.
2. Add vegetables, lentils, stock, tamari, and seasonings. Cover, and cook on low until lentils and vegetables are tender, 6 to 8 hours.
